微信扫一扫打赏支持
上一页 1 ··· 129 130 131 132 133 134 135 136 137 ··· 498 下一页
摘要: ES6课程 1、ECMAScript介绍 一、总结 一句话总结: es是ECMAScript,是标准,js是es的实现 1、ES的几个重要版本? *、ES5 : 09年发布 *、ES6(ES2015) : 15年发布, 也称为ECMA2015 *、ES7(ES2016) : 16年发布, 也称为EC 阅读全文
posted @ 2020-04-06 12:44 范仁义 阅读(293) 评论(0) 推荐(0)
摘要: laravel缓存事件(比如监听缓存失效) 一、总结 一句话总结: 缓存是有缓存事件的,比如cache.hit、cache.missed、cache.write、cache.delete 要在每次缓存操作时执行相应程序,你可以监听缓存触发的事件,通常,你可以将这些缓存处理器代码放到EventServ 阅读全文
posted @ 2020-04-06 09:32 范仁义 阅读(536) 评论(0) 推荐(0)
摘要: sleep实现原理 一、总结 一句话总结: a、sleep():Linux中并没有提供系统调用sleep(),sleep()是在库函数中实现的,它是通过调用alarm()来设定报警时间,调用sigsuspend()将进程挂起在信号SIGALARM上,sleep()只能精确到秒级上。 b、nanosl 阅读全文
posted @ 2020-04-06 09:25 范仁义 阅读(2386) 评论(0) 推荐(0)
摘要: 定时器的使用和原理浅析,alarm/sleep函数 一、总结 一句话总结: alarm函数(进程不阻塞):使用alarm函数和signal函数,要注册信号处理回调函数,就是说进程并没有被睡眠,处理动作是以信号的形式注册到内核中,当时间到时,以信号的方式打断进程,进入信号处理程序。 sleep函数(进 阅读全文
posted @ 2020-04-06 09:21 范仁义 阅读(1471) 评论(0) 推荐(0)
摘要: 使用 Laravel 的 监听者模式实现缓存机制的松散耦合 一、总结 一句话总结: 1、既然要实现松散耦合的缓存机制,那就是要做到有没有缓存都没事。有缓存的话就走缓存,然后那边的模块内部实现一个包括过期时间呀啥啥的缓存机制,没有收到缓存模块的响应的时候就继续走原来的应用逻辑,一样可以正常响应。 2、 阅读全文
posted @ 2020-04-06 09:09 范仁义 阅读(378) 评论(0) 推荐(0)
摘要: laravel通过 Redis 定时执行脚本 一、总结 一句话总结: 方法一:通过监听 redis 的 key 失效事件,来定时进行业务逻辑操作。 方法二:第一种方式由于很吃 Redis 的稳定性,万一 Redis 的服务可不用那么,将有一部分的数据丢失,所以改进一下 Redis 使用方式 - 有序 阅读全文
posted @ 2020-04-06 09:02 范仁义 阅读(540) 评论(0) 推荐(0)
摘要: PHP 常量定义以及用法 一、总结 一句话总结: define:define是函数,不能在对象中定义,但可在类中定义使用:define('CL',10); static静态常量:是一个变量,可以常量的语法访问,就是::,可以没有实例化也能访问:public static $a = "呵呵"; con 阅读全文
posted @ 2020-04-06 08:47 范仁义 阅读(797) 评论(0) 推荐(0)
摘要: legend3 28、缓存优化的几种策略 一、总结 一句话总结: 1、数据库和缓存同时更新,用更新好的数据库来更新缓存,这种数据最准确:比如评论数量,比如用户点赞、收藏 2、数据库和缓存同时更新,是同时更新数据库和更新缓存,不是用数据库来更新缓存(相比于上一种,少了一次查数据库的操作): 3、只更新 阅读全文
posted @ 2020-04-06 08:34 范仁义 阅读(167) 评论(0) 推荐(0)
摘要: legend3 27、清除无用或者多余图片 一、总结 一句话总结: 清除无用或者多余图片很简单,可以直接遍历数据库,可以找到有用的图片的链接,在此基础上就可以很方便的删除无用的图片 1、cdn加速oss域名配置问题(域名解析的时候是域名指向oss,还是域名指向cdn)? 一个域名只能配一条解析记录, 阅读全文
posted @ 2020-04-06 08:06 范仁义 阅读(309) 评论(0) 推荐(0)
摘要: laravel字段排除功能 一、总结 一句话总结: 字段排除功能可以不需要,需要查啥自己手动写在sql里面 首先你要知道你表里所有的字段,这样才能进行排除。知道表里的所有字段的方式我能想到的有两种,一种是写死在你的 Model 里,还有一种是去数据库查询一遍。两种都有弊端. 第一种写死,如果你数据库 阅读全文
posted @ 2020-04-06 02:47 范仁义 阅读(2765) 评论(0) 推荐(0)
上一页 1 ··· 129 130 131 132 133 134 135 136 137 ··· 498 下一页